Welcome to Jaisalmer, the golden city of Rajasthan! Start your day by visiting the magnificent Jaisalmer Fort, also known as Sonar Quila, in the morning. Explore the grand palaces, stunning Jain temples, and narrow streets bustling with shops and vibrant markets. In the afternoon, take a camel safari and venture into the Thar Desert, enjoying the serenity and beautiful sunset. In the evening, treat yourself to a traditional Rajasthani dinner while enjoying folk music and dance performances.
On your second day, imm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age of Jaisalmer. In the morning, visit the Patwon Ki Haveli, a cluster of five intricately carved mansions that showcase exquisite architecture. Afterward, head to the Nathmal Ki Haveli, which is famous for its unique blend of Rajput and Islamic architectural styles. In the afternoon, visit the Desert Cultural Centre and Museum to learn about the history, traditions, and lifestyle of the desert region. Enjoy a mesmerizing sunset view from the Sam Sand Dunes in the evening.
Embark on a journey to explore the fascinating forts and temples of Jaisalmer. Begin your day with a visit to the Bada Bagh, an oasis-like garden with royal cenotaphs. Witness the architectural marvel of the Surya Gate and the Amar Sagar Jain Temple. In the afternoon, visit the Tazia Tower, known for its intricate carvings and stunning craftsmanship. Explore the stunning architecture of the stunning Jain Temples, known for their intricately carved marble and sandstone designs. In the evening, catch a traditional puppet show.
Experience the rural heritage and cultural extravaganza of Jaisalmer on this day. In the morning, visit Kuldhara, an abandoned village with a captivating history. Explore the ruins and discover the intriguing tales surrounding its abandonment. In the afternoon, visit the Desert National Park, home to diverse flora and fauna, including blackbucks and desert foxes. Engage in bird-watching and enjoy the serenity of the desert landscape. In the evening, witness the vibrant Rajasthani folk dance and music performances.
On your final day, bid farewell to the enchanting city of Jaisalmer. Take a morning walk along Gadisar Lake, a serene spot surrounded by beautiful temples and ghats. Explore the local markets for handicrafts, textiles, and exquisite jewelry. In the afternoon, indulge in a delicious Rajasthani thali for lunch. Wrap up your trip by admiring the stunning architecture of the Salim Singh Ki Haveli and the Patwa Ki Haveli. Depart with fond memories of Jaisalmer's rich history and golden landscapes.
